Dog Friendly Unique barn conversion in Saddleworth
The Barn originally part of Shiloh Farm dates back to the 17th century and has been recently converted from stables keeping the old charm and character of the building. As well as one large bedroom with a fitted bath, an open plan kitchen diner, there is a comfortable lounge with a large sofa. . There is a small terrace outside the barn which is the perfect place to have a drink in the evening sun. We also have a 100m2 garden which is securely fenced, with a patio set to enjoy the summer sun.
Situated amongst the Saddleworth Hills, people staying at this property will have the ability to enjoy the large areas of open countryside with many local footpaths to explore, with stunning views across Saddleworth to the right and views over Manchester to the left. Parking available next to the property.
During your stay you can enjoy the entire house, the terrace outside and a huge 100m2 lawn garden with views of farmland and the surrounding hills perfect for relaxing on a summers day.
The barn may not be suitable for guests with reduced mobility as there are steps to the front door and to the garden.
On the Edge of the Peak District National Park, Shiloh Farm is situated a 30 minute walk from the village center (Delph) offers a selection of pubs and restaurants, with cuisine available from traditional English fish and chips, to Tapas and Indian cuisine. There are 3 pubs within walking distance the closest being The Roebuck, (10 minutes away) offering good home cooked food and stunning views of Oldham and Manchester on a clear day. In addition to this Uppermill is a 10 minute drive, with a great offering cafes, bars restaurants, museums and walks on offer there is something for everyone.
To enjoy the area you will need a car. The nearest public transport is about a mile away, from the Metrolink station there are 4 trams an hour into Manchester City Center. There’s many public footpaths and the lanes in the area have very little traffic, so walking and cycling are also great ways to explore.
